Transaction 22369032f01656beb7c23d8ef3d2821767d66d5f695f2514fe131fa856c81763
1 Input
1 Output
-
22369032f01656beb7c23d8ef3d2821767d66d5f695f2514fe131fa856c81763:0
- value
- 198240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bca9ef399e9d1483d48116e8b593ffc2e890f33 OP_EQUAL
- address
- 3ESAaZAkrR1hV98gBm58qg3S3rx9u6FmkA